@AMIGOES,

What they've been doing?  see below,

Busy chasing viewing centers around
Busy upgrading their decoder to pop up smart card no from viewing center to be able to diactivate the card, they invested a lot in this software
Busy doing court cases with CTL & musician asso
Busy increasing subscription fee from 3.5k to 6k
Busy paying urfriend for media relation
As in busy getting themselves busy on secondary issues,
It's absolutely poor managerial skill,

Kennis music, mohit are one of the leading recor lable, they should try and invade alaba, arrest the boys and let's wait if the label will last the next few months,

Piracy, rights, contents etc are not what individual can fight in Nigeria, the govt need to come in and a lot of factors are also into play here, Apart from this am sure Subair must have step on toes here, 'cos everything is politics in Nigeria, CTL is not owned by ordinary Ibo bizman, they are been backed by godfathers who may be position to stop the bank guarantee required for the EPL,

Re: Too Little Too Late? Hitv Slashes Rates! by olason(m): 4:14pm On Aug 12, 2010
all, the chicken has come to ruse like they use to say. HITV had all the chances in the world to improve themselves with quality programming content but instead they concentrated there energy on chasing viewing centres and the rest 4gething that anoda round of bidding for the EPL was jus round the corner. In as much as I love my country i will never settle for less in terms of quality SERVICE delivery. if the so called outsiders can deliver then let the party begins.
